As always, every day (technically) is Power Up Day-- nothing stops us from powering up whatever tokens we have no matter the amount. While this is true, some days are more special than others.

Today is another edition of a monthly event begun by LeoFinance in Summer 2022: LPUD, where LEO is powered up event-style on the 15th of each month. 150 LEO is needed to qualify for the LPUD event.

Why Power Up at All?

Powering up-- no matter how or when-- is how we increase our voting power. Voting power is how we increase the upvotes we give to others, and it's how we in turn receive greater earnings from the upvotes of others.

It is true for HIVE at the base layer, and it's also true for all Hive Engine tokens at Layer 2, especially LEO.

In another time, people of another time placed money into savings accounts to earn several percentage points of interest (unlike the virtually zero percent it's been for at least 10 years), powering up our tokens has the same effect.
